Democratic Services & Elections Manager

The Christchurch and East Dorset Partnership are developing shared services to support both Councils and have recently restructured their Democratic Services and Election teams.

The Partnership is seeking to recruit a highly motivated and forward thinking Partnership Manager to run the new shared service team of Democratic Services and Elections, including Civic Support.

It is essential that as well as being able to demonstrate detailed knowledge and experience of working in both Democratic and Electoral Services that you also have strong leadership skills and extensive management experience.

You will be responsible for the elections team and will act as a Deputy Electoral Returning Officer, and assist in organising and conducting such elections. You will be responsible for implementing the changes brought about by Individual Electoral Registration.

This is a politically restricted post.
